The Waynoka Police Department is an established public safety body committed to maintaining harmony for its citizens in Waynoka, Oklahoma. Located at 201 East Cecil Street, Waynoka, Oklahoma, 73860 in the heart of Waynoka, the department proudly serves the community within Woods County.

The Waynoka department, reachable via its contact phone number 580-824-0344, operates with a team of professional public safety personnel, detectives, and supportive administrative staff who are all dedicated to ensuring citizen security and upholding the rule of law in the locality. With an ethos centered around community involvement, integrity, and transparency, the Waynoka Law Enforcement Agency strives to build trust within the public it serves.

Police Arrest and Access to Records

The Waynoka Police Office is in charge of the detention and detention of individuals suspected of committed crimes within its jurisdiction. Records of these incidents, along with other police records, are available to the public in compliance with the Oklahoma Open Records Act.

To request detention logs, interested individuals can contact the Records Division of the Waynoka Law Enforcement Agency either by telephone or in person at the department’s address 201 East Cecil Street, Waynoka, Oklahoma, 73860. It’s recommended to provide as much data as possible regarding the person or incident in question to facilitate a more swift search. Typically, the process could include the payment of a nominal fee to cover administrative costs associated with the request.
